It was used commonly about everywhere. Asbestosis develops in about 20 years time so basically anyone of us can still get it. Anyone who worked with industry or did any kind of renovation at home is at serious risk to get contaminated. Not to mention cars brake pads were made of asbestos for decades. Ever changed brakes huh? A bit dusty eh?

Asbestos was used in fire retardant clothing, several cements for building, cooking plates, brakepads, insulation of several sorts (spray asbestos, bushings, plate insulators, tiles) They're still found in multiple homes all around the world. Thousands of industrial plants, military vehicles (been in the navy?) aeroplanes, boats, concrete. Pulverize anything that was made 1880 - 1980's and you may be exposed to asbestos.
